Course Title: Hairstyling and Design III

Go to Course Outline

Code:

HSTL1313P

Admit Term:

2026 Fall 1264

Credits:

5

Description:

In the final term of this course, we will learn how to create our own designs for an up style and how to manipulate the hair to achieve your desired final result. Wigs, hair pieces and extensions are a very big part of what is happening in the industry today. We will learn all about the various artificial and natural fibres used and how to measure and cut wigs, toupees and hairpieces. There are many types of extensions used today to enhance natural hair. We will learn installation and removal of different types of extensions.

Prerequisites for this course

  • HSTL1203 - Hairstyling and Design II
